Getting started
PLEASE READ ‘LET’S TALK SAFETY’ AT THE BEGINNING BEFORE USE
Before you Begin
CAUTION
•The steamer and accessories get very hot during use, always allow them to cool down before handling.
•Always unplug and switch off the steamer when assembling.
•Always switch off the steamer before emptying the water tank or changing the cloths/accessories.
IMPORTANT
•Please refer to floor manufacturer’s care recommendations before use and test the steamer on a hidden area of flooring to begin with.
•Test for colour fastness in a small hidden area of upholstery/fabric to check for colour removal before use.
•When using the steamer, basic safety precautions should always be observed.
•Don’t aim the steamer at people, animals, plants and electrical components or wires. Never touch the steam jet or floorhead from a short distance (there is a risk of scalding).
•The steamer is equipped with a thermostat and a thermal cut-out. If for any reason the steamer overheats it will switch off. If this happens turn off and unplug the steamer, allow to cool for at least 2 to 4 hours and re-try.
Assembling your steamer
Push the main body down into the floorhead until it clicks into place.
Stand the steamer upright by pushing the main body forward to lock into position.
Push the handle into main body until it clicks into place.
Insert tools into the back of the steamer.
Insert concentration nozzle into the storage hook on the back of handle.
Using your machine
IMPORTANT
•If you don’t want to use detergent on your flooring, turn detergent dial to OFF position.
•Always test on an inconspicuous area of flooring first before using detergent.
•Don’t over fill the clean water/detergent tanks or exceed the maximum amount required.
•Don’t use the steamer without water in the water tank. Always top up with water in good time.
Filling water tank
Press the water tank release buttons and pull the water tank to remove.
Pull the tab on the water tank cap to open.
Fill the water tank with 260ml of water, replace the cap and push firmly to close.
Slide the water tank back into the machine until it clicks into place.
Filling detergent tank
Press the release buttons and pull the detergent tank to remove.
Twist the detergent tank cap anti-clockwise and lift to remove.
Pour 50ml of Vax detergent and 150ml of water into the detergent tank.
Replace the detergent tank cap and twist clockwise to close.
Replace the detergent tank back into the steamer and push until it clicks into place.
